In recent weeks, Liam has been documenting his travels in Argentina and attended the concert of his former bandmate, Niall Horan. He had also been joined by girlfriend Kate on the trip. In his final Snapchat posts, Liam revealed the couple were staying with a friend in Argentina.
The singer, who had previous relationships with Cheryl Cole and Maya Henry, was first seen with Kate in October 2022. They were rocked by split rumours in May 2023 but they were still dating and sharing snippets of their romance at the time of Liam's death. Liam revealed he felt he didn't need to hide his relationship with Kate from the world.
"I'm kind of at the place in my life now where I just realize it's not worth sacrificing my happiness just because somebody might see something," he said 2019 interview with "I don't have anything to hide."
Kate and Liam were first seen together at a Halloween party in October 2022 as they headed out dressed as Tommy Lee and Pamela Anderson. The influencer shared a photo of them to her Instagram and later showed them on a trip to Rome. They went on to make their red carpet debut in December that year.
The couple headed to the British Fashion Awards and Kate shared a photo from the night. Liam shared a gushing comment as he wrote: “Who is that lucky lucky dashing young man next to you nah seriously you look fantastic I coulda just told you that as your on the sofa next to me but you know tech and phones n stuff.”
Shortly after going public with their romance, Kate was hit by nasty messages from trolls suggesting she was only with Liam for his money. Liam publicly defended Kate as, according , he screenshotted the message and shared it on his Instagram Stories. Alongside it, Liam wrote: "Gotta say you could tell me anything and I couldn't be turned. I've never felt a love like I do for Katelyn. We make each other better people."
He added: "If it was just for the money I'd give her all of it. It's not though (please remember I'm hella sexy) and I know I'm fun and a loveable person. And I don't give a f*** to say that for the first time in my life I'm happy to be me and that's priceless.”
